Medullary carcinoma of the breast: a tumour lacking keratin 19

Histopathology, 1994
The presence of keratin 19 (K19) was searched for by immunostaining in 16 medullary carcinomas, comprising 12 typical and four atypical cases, in 29 undifferentiated high‐grade carcinomas (NOS‐HG) with conspicuous lymphoid response and in 12 well differentiated low‐grade carcinomas (NOS‐LG).

Patterns of keratins 8, 18 and 19 during gonadal differentiation in the mouse: sex- and time-dependent expression of keratin 19

Differentiation, 1998
The acidic keratins K18 and K19 have been shown to display a sex-specific expression during gonadal differentiation in the rat. To extend these findings, we have undertaken a study of the expression of genes encoding for K18 and K19 and their basic partner K8 in the mouse from 10.5 days of gestation until adulthood, using immunofluorescence, in situ ...

Keratin 19 expression in the adult and developing human mammary gland

The Histochemical Journal, 1990
In the adult human mammary gland, most of the luminal epithelial cells express keratin 19 (K19+). However, in some small ducts and terminal ductal lobular units where branching would be expected to occur during pregnancy, the pattern of expression of this keratin is heterogeneous.
